One of the key tools for efficient and secure communication is the p25 encrypted radio system. P25, short for Project 25, is a set of standards developed by the Association of Public Safety Communications Officials International (APCO) to ensure interoperability between digital two-way radios used by public safety and emergency services agencies. These radios provide encrypted communication to protect sensitive information from unauthorized access.
p25 encrypted radio systems offer a wide range of advantages over traditional analog radio systems. One of the primary benefits is the enhanced security provided by encryption. With the growing threat of cyber attacks and eavesdropping, secure communication is more important than ever. P25 encryption uses advanced algorithms to scramble messages, making them unreadable to anyone who does not have the authorized decryption key. This level of security ensures that sensitive information such as patient data, criminal investigations, and tactical operations remains confidential.
Another advantage of p25 encrypted radios is their digital communication capabilities. Unlike analog radios, which are prone to interference and static, digital radios deliver clear and reliable audio quality. This improved sound quality is critical during emergency situations when every word spoken must be clearly understood. P25 radios also offer advanced features such as noise cancellation and voice compression, which further enhance communication in noisy environments.
Interoperability is another key benefit of P25 encrypted radio systems. In emergency situations where multiple agencies need to coordinate their response, interoperable communication is essential for a seamless operation. P25 radios can communicate with different makes and models of radios, ensuring that all agencies involved in a response can effectively share information and coordinate their efforts. This interoperability extends beyond local agencies to regional, state, and federal levels, allowing for effective communication between jurisdictions.
P25 encrypted radio systems are also designed to be highly resilient and reliable. Built to withstand harsh environmental conditions, these radios are durable and long-lasting, making them suitable for use in demanding situations such as search and rescue operations, firefighting, and disaster response. P25 radios are also resistant to interference from other radio frequencies, ensuring that communication remains clear and uninterrupted even in congested radio environments.
